Rapid conductance based analysis for patch clamp sensors

详细技术说明
Title: Rapid Conductance Based Analysis for Patch Clamp Sensors Invention: The invention is a data acquisition and analysis protocol for ligand-ion channel interactions. The approach allows for the quantification of ligand concentrations in less than 30 milliseconds. This approach can monitor rapid, dynamic chemical processes in a feasible manner. Background: Ion channels have been researched as an option for label-free detection of analytes without optical or electrochemical activity. The process begins with binding of the target analyte to an ion channel to change the ion flux, which can be detected electrochemically.
